ZIP code 57451 covers Ipswich, South Dakota, with a population of about 2,568 and a median household income of $85,795.

Where 57451 is

Ipswich, South Dakota — the area the Census Bureau draws for this ZIP code. ZIP codes are sets of delivery routes rather than areas, so this is the Census approximation of one, not a Postal Service boundary.
